Vitalik Buterin’s AI take is less about chatbots and more about proving software is safe
Summary
Vitalik Buterin argues that AI can make formal verification more practical, helping generate specs and proofs to ensure software behaves correctly, potentially transforming critical software development beyond Ethereum.
Similar Articles
@VitalikButerin: Many people have claimed that with AI-assisted bug finding, secure code (and hence trustless anything) will be impossib…
Vitalik Buterin shares an optimistic take on AI-assisted formal verification as a path to secure, trustless code, linking to his blog post explaining the basics of formal verification using Lean.
@VitalikButerin: "Even more bugs are inevitable, software is all going to become probabilistic now" is cope. "AI bug-finding means we ha…
Vitalik Buterin argues against the narratives that bugs are inevitable and that AI bug-finding necessitates closed-source, stating that writing secure code has become harder but not impossible.
@MaximeRivest: https://x.com/MaximeRivest/status/2017688441404764174
A skeptical software engineer argues that chatbots are overhyped and that the real value of AI lies in using language models as reliable compute components in engineering systems, encouraging developers to integrate AI into practical applications beyond conversational interfaces.
@garrytan: It's not that AI lets you write code faster. Plenty of people have noticed that. It's that AI lets you verify at a leve…
The post argues that the primary value of AI in programming is not just writing code faster, but enabling sustainable high-level verification and testing that was previously too costly in terms of human effort.
@SaitoWu: https://x.com/SaitoWu/status/2055623767066550403
Vitalik Buterin discusses how humans should respond in the age of AI on the a16z podcast, proposing the creation of "sanctuary technology" to protect privacy and sovereignty, emphasizing that humans should take the helm proactively rather than passively rely on AI.